|
|
@ -287,6 +287,7 @@ public class ModelRecordTypeServiceImpl extends ServiceImpl<ModelRecordTypeMappe
|
|
|
|
// 这里查询任务是否完成,如果完成了,就给结果
|
|
|
|
// 这里查询任务是否完成,如果完成了,就给结果
|
|
|
|
Optional<CaseTaskRecord> caseTaskRecordOpt = caseTaskRecordService.lambdaQuery().eq(CaseTaskRecord::getCaseId, caseId)
|
|
|
|
Optional<CaseTaskRecord> caseTaskRecordOpt = caseTaskRecordService.lambdaQuery().eq(CaseTaskRecord::getCaseId, caseId)
|
|
|
|
.eq(CaseTaskRecord::getRecordId, recordId).oneOpt();
|
|
|
|
.eq(CaseTaskRecord::getRecordId, recordId).oneOpt();
|
|
|
|
|
|
|
|
|
|
|
|
if (caseTaskRecordOpt.isPresent()) {
|
|
|
|
if (caseTaskRecordOpt.isPresent()) {
|
|
|
|
CaseTaskRecord caseTaskRecord = caseTaskRecordOpt.get();
|
|
|
|
CaseTaskRecord caseTaskRecord = caseTaskRecordOpt.get();
|
|
|
|
// 0未执行 1正在执行 2执行成功 3执行超时
|
|
|
|
// 0未执行 1正在执行 2执行成功 3执行超时
|
|
|
@ -306,6 +307,8 @@ public class ModelRecordTypeServiceImpl extends ServiceImpl<ModelRecordTypeMappe
|
|
|
|
// 更新为1执行中
|
|
|
|
// 更新为1执行中
|
|
|
|
throw new BusinessException("笔录解析任务未完成,请等待");
|
|
|
|
throw new BusinessException("笔录解析任务未完成,请等待");
|
|
|
|
}
|
|
|
|
}
|
|
|
|
|
|
|
|
}else {
|
|
|
|
|
|
|
|
throw new BusinessException("请先进行笔录提取");
|
|
|
|
}
|
|
|
|
}
|
|
|
|
// 这里进行查询
|
|
|
|
// 这里进行查询
|
|
|
|
return tripleInfoService.lambdaQuery().eq(TripleInfo::getRecordId, recordId).list();
|
|
|
|
return tripleInfoService.lambdaQuery().eq(TripleInfo::getRecordId, recordId).list();
|
|
|
|